Employment issues? ?

I apologize for the length but I need to give a lot of detail to get the help I need. I have been a portrait studio manager for 10 years, recently I changed jobs, I was offered and accepted an assistant manager position with the understanding that I would get a manager's position when one came available, the first day I started I was informed that I would not be an assistant manager yet??? the 'manager' was a 24 year old girl that has only been a manager for 2 months, I could tell right off she was intimidated by my experience, she wouldn't teach me anything or let me do anything, I taught myself what I needed to know, I went to work everyday on time and my work was exceptional, customers loved me, to make a long story short, she called me this morning, 2 hours before my shift and told me that she new I wanted a manager's position and since she didn't have one available she didn't want me to come back, in other words, she fired me for no reason. she had been lying to her boss about me so when she called this morning I asked my husband to listen, so he was a witness to the conversation. what can I do about this, I know I can get unemployment but do I have a lawsuit or will the labor board help with anything? I have the job offer that I never got in writing
Additional Details
I wasn't at the same place for 10 years, I have 10 years total management experience. I am in NC


    




Jim L
If this is a larger company, I would contact their home office HR department first thing and ask for the highest HR executive, probably a VP. If it is a local business I would contact the highest ranking executive that I could find. If you have the job offer in writing that is a lot of evidence. Beyond that, you have two ways to proceed, First, you may want to contact an attorney who has knowledge of employment law in your state. I'm not a lawyer, but you have suffered damages by quitting a job where you had 10 years experience for a position that didn't exist. You may be entitled to compensation beyond UC. Second, call the appropriate office in your state - labor department, maybe even the state attorney general, and ask to talk to someone about your situation.
